Categories of Tools

There are several categories of tools that are particularly useful for digital advocacy:

  • Social Media Platforms: These are the backbone of any digital advocacy campaign. They allow you to share your message with a large audience and engage with supporters.
  • Content Creation Software: Tools like Canva and Adobe Spark make it easy to create eye-catching graphics and videos that grab attention.
  • Analytics Tools: Understanding the impact of your advocacy efforts is crucial. Analytics tools help you track engagement and measure success.
  • Email Marketing Platforms: Email remains a powerful way to reach supporters directly. Tools like Mailchimp and Constant Contact help you manage your email campaigns.
  • Petition Platforms: Sites like Change.org and Avaaz allow you to create and promote petitions, mobilizing support for your cause.

Social Media Platforms

Social media is where most digital advocacy happens. Here are the top platforms to consider:

  • Twitter: Known for its real-time updates, Twitter is great for sharing news and engaging with influencers. Use hashtags to join broader conversations.
  • Facebook: With its large user base, Facebook is ideal for building communities and sharing in-depth content.
  • Instagram: Visual storytelling is key on Instagram. Use images and videos to connect emotionally with your audience.
  • TikTok: This platform is perfect for reaching younger audiences with short, engaging videos.

Content Creation Software

Creating compelling content is crucial for capturing attention. Here are some top tools:

  • Canva: Canva offers a user-friendly interface and a wide range of templates for creating graphics, presentations, and more.
  • Adobe Spark: This tool is great for creating videos and web pages with minimal effort. It's perfect for advocacy campaigns that need a visual punch.

Analytics Tools

Measuring the impact of your advocacy efforts is essential. Here are some top analytics tools:

  • Google Analytics: This free tool provides detailed insights into website traffic and user behavior.
  • Hootsuite: Hootsuite allows you to manage multiple social media accounts and track engagement metrics in one place.

Email Marketing Platforms

Email is a direct way to reach your supporters. Here are some top tools:

  • Mailchimp: Mailchimp offers a range of features for creating and managing email campaigns, including automation and analytics.
  • Constant Contact: This tool is known for its ease of use and excellent customer support, making it a great choice for beginners.

Petition Platforms

Petitions are a powerful way to mobilize support. Here are some top platforms:

  • Change.org: This is one of the most popular petition platforms, with a large user base and a track record of successful campaigns.
  • Avaaz: Avaaz focuses on global issues and has a strong community of activists.

Tips for Effective Use

To make the most of these tools, consider the following tips:

  • Be Consistent: Regularly update your social media and email campaigns to keep your audience engaged.
  • Use Data: Leverage analytics to understand what's working and adjust your strategy accordingly.
  • Engage Authentically: Respond to comments and messages to build a community around your cause.
  • Collaborate: Partner with other advocates or organizations to amplify your message.
